The Heart of Southern Cooking: Comfort and Tradition

Mount Airy’s culinary roots are deeply intertwined with the traditions of Southern cooking. Here, you’ll find restaurants that honor the rich heritage of the region, serving up plates piled high with soul-satisfying dishes that evoke memories of home. These establishments aren’t just about food; they’re about community, hospitality, and sharing a taste of history.

One such gem is Snappy Lunch. This local institution has been serving up its famous “pork chop sandwich” since 1923. It’s a simple yet perfect creation: a thin, crispy pork chop served on a soft bun with mustard, slaw, and chili. The atmosphere is decidedly old-school, with counter seating and a friendly, bustling energy. Snappy Lunch is more than just a restaurant; it’s a piece of Mount Airy’s history, a place where generations have gathered to enjoy a classic Southern meal. Every bite transports you back to a simpler time. One local describes it as “the heart of Mount Airy” and you can taste the heart in every bite.

One such option is the Mount Airy Farmers Market. Held seasonally, the farmers market is a vibrant gathering place where local farmers and artisans sell their fresh produce, homemade goods, and crafts. It’s a great opportunity to support local businesses and sample the flavors of the region. You can find everything from juicy tomatoes and crisp apples to homemade jams and artisan cheeses. It’s the perfect place to gather ingredients for a home-cooked meal or simply enjoy the atmosphere and mingle with the locals.
